2. Safety Information
- DO NOT EXCEED WEIGHT CAPACITY: The aluminum cargo carrier has a maximum load capacity of 500 lbs. The RV bumper hitch receiver adapter has a maximum tongue weight capacity of 200 lbs. Always adhere to these limits.
- SECURE CARGO: Always use appropriate tie-downs (not included) to secure all cargo to prevent shifting or falling during transit.
- PROPER INSTALLATION: Ensure all bolts, nuts, and pins are securely fastened according to the assembly instructions. Regularly check for tightness before each use.
- VISIBILITY: The cargo carrier is equipped with reflectors for enhanced visibility. Ensure they are clean and unobstructed.
- VEHICLE CLEARANCE: Verify that the installed carrier and cargo do not obstruct vehicle lights, license plates, or exhaust. Maintain adequate ground clearance.
- DRIVING PRECAUTIONS: Drive cautiously, especially over bumps or uneven terrain, as the added weight and length can affect vehicle handling.

4.2. Installing the RV Bumper Hitch Receiver Adapter
The hitch receiver adapter is designed to convert a 4"-4.5" RV bumper into a standard 2" x 2" hitch receiver.
- Position the adapter securely onto your RV bumper.
- Tighten all bolts and nuts to ensure a firm, stable connection.

5. Operating Instructions
5.1. Loading Cargo
Place items evenly across the carrier's surface. Distribute weight to maintain vehicle balance. Avoid placing all heavy items on one side or at the very end of the carrier.

5.2. Securing Cargo
Utilize the multiple tie-down points on the carrier to firmly secure all items using bungee cords, ratchet straps, or cargo nets. Ensure no items can shift, fall, or obstruct your view or vehicle lights.

6. Maintenance
To ensure the longevity and safe operation of your cargo carrier and adapter:
- CLEANING: Clean the aluminum and steel components regularly with mild soap and water. Avoid abrasive cleaners that could damage the finish.
- INSPECTION: Periodically inspect all bolts, nuts, and welds for signs of wear, damage, or corrosion. Tighten any loose fasteners.
- STORAGE: When not in use, store the cargo carrier in a dry place to prevent corrosion and prolong its lifespan.
7. Troubleshooting
- Wobbling/Rattling: If the carrier wobbles or rattles excessively, ensure the hitch pin is fully inserted and secured. Consider using an anti-rattle hitch device (sold separately) for a more stable connection.
- Difficulty Inserting Hitch Pin: Ensure the carrier shank is fully inserted into the receiver and aligned with the pinholes. Check for any obstructions.
- Corrosion: While the aluminum is rust-resistant and steel components are powder-coated, prolonged exposure to harsh elements can cause wear. Regular cleaning and inspection can mitigate this.
